# Break-Glass: Catalog Cache Invalidation

Scope: the Pinrow product catalog at Veldstone Retail. If stale prices persist after a purge and the Hollowmere invalidation queue is wedged, use break-glass to flush the edge tier directly. Contractors: get verbal sign-off from the catalog lead first. Steps: open the Hollowmere admin shell, select emergency-flush, confirm the tenant, and run it once — repeated flushes thrash the origin. Access is logged and expires after 20 minutes. Unseal the admin shell with the passphrase below.

recovery phrase for kahop-tajog: istix-casvan

Subject: New static-analysis baseline for Larkspool plugins

Release channel,

The Larkspool 4.2 baseline file now ships with the SDK. Plugin authors must regenerate suppressions against it before submitting; legacy baselines are rejected at intake. No grandfathering this cycle. Diff noise should drop sharply once you rebase. Questions go to the plugin triage board. The baseline was produced from the build identified directly below.

pipeline stamp: htk9_ce63042d9

Subject: Zero-downtime schema migrations — read before your first release

Short version: every migration on Pondwright ships in two phases. Phase one adds columns and backfills; phase two flips reads and drops old fields only after a full release cycle. Never combine phases in one deploy. The migration runner blocks destructive changes by default — don't override the guard without sign-off from the data team. Rollbacks must be tested in staging against a production snapshot. The complete playbook, including the phase checklist, is here.

runbook for tajop-bafog: https://confluence.qorvelsys.internal/display/browse/display/display/9d3e

Handover Note — Reseller Programme

Mira, here's where things stand with the Brightvale reseller scheme. Twelve partners onboarded, three on probation for margin abuse, and the tiering review is half done. Orla has the partner scorecards; lean on her. The Q3 incentive pot is untouched, so you've got room to manoeuvre. The strategic context you'll need is set out in the note below.

board note of bawep-tajef: Queniusek Systems plans to raise the Quenvan list price by 53.1 percent in March. The pricing group signed off on a budget of $176.4 million for Project Drueth. The renewal with Casionix Partners closes at $142.5 million a year, 8.3 percent below the last contract. Project Fraax slips by six weeks because of the tooling delay.